Weather & Tides

When planning to go anywhere near the coast be it for bait collecting, fishing, or just out for a wander with the family it is absolutely essential to know the times of the tides.

All through the year people are being “rescued” by the RNLI because they have been cut off from the mainland by rising tides. Mumbles Head, Worms Head and Burry Holmes are the three main areas that this happens. But its also easy to become cut off if you are clambering over rocks at low water and you don’t see the tide rising around you.

You can pick up a “tide table” at a local tackle shop.

Alternatively take a look at the National Tidal and Sea Level Facility web site.

Weather is just as important as the tide times and can both affect the fishing and the state of the tide. Make sure you check the marine forecast as well as the normal met office forecast before you go.
